Cebu was named Villa del Santissimo Nombre de Jesus by Miguel Lopez de Legaspi.
Cebu was ruled by Rajah Tupas when Miguel Lopez de Legaspi and his men revisited Cebu in the hope of pacifying the natives and eventually controlling the country.
Cebu Pacific is owned by Cebu Air, Inc., which is a subsidiary of the Gokongwei Group, a prominent Filipino conglomerate. The airline was established in 1988 and has since become a major player in the low-cost airline market in the Philippines and across Asia. The Gokongwei family, through their investments, holds a significant stake in Cebu Air, Inc.

Miligoy de Cebu is dance originating from Cebu City in the Philippines, possibly or most likely originating from the Spanish period amongst the elite Cebuanos and danced during fiestas. It might have originated in the Parian district considering that was where most of the elite lived.
Waltz. Gallop. Change Step. Polka. Mazurka. Sway Balance. Close Step. Leap.
